AUSTINTOWN — Betty Barwick, 92, died on Thursday, Sept. 4, 2025.

She was born on Jan. 23, 1933, in Morgantown, W.Va., a daughter of Felix Metheny and Violet Sprague Metheny. 

Betty was a graduate of West Virginia University High School, where she played the slide trombone in the band. 

She worked as a chef at Mr. B’s Catering, which later became Charly’s Family Restaurant. 

Betty was renowned for her generosity and her ability to feed everyone who entered her home. Sundays were special in the Barwick home, where family and friends gathered to enjoy her delicious meals.

Betty raised funds for numerous charitable organizations, with UNICEF holding a special place in her heart. She was very involved with the Wedgewood Park EC Church in Youngstown, where she served as choir director. 

As a talented seamstress, Betty enjoyed creating beautiful robes and sewing clothing for her children.

Betty is survived by her sons, William B. Barwick and Franklin W. Barwick; daughters, Betty (Dave) Campana, Jean (John) Schaefer, Diana Barwick, Nannette (Dave) McKnight, Audrey (Dave) MacDonald and Linda (Ron) Raubenstraw; 14 grandchildren and 18 great-grandchildren.

In addition to her parents, Betty was preceded in death by her husband, William Barwick; son, Daniel C. Barwick; brother, George Metheny; and grandson, Corey Barwick. 

Betty will be buried in Brunstetter Cemetery.
